A local court in Meghalaya has extended the police custody of Sonam and Raj , key accused in the alleged murder of Raja Raghuvanshi , by two more days. The court passed the order after police sought more time to interrogate the two individuals in connection with the killing.In the same hearing, the court remanded three alleged contract killers to 14-day judicial custody. These individuals were arrested and are suspected to have been hired to carry out the murder..Raja Raghuvanshi was found dead under suspicious circumstances in East Khasi Hills district last week. According to investigators, the murder appears to have been planned and executed with help from professional hitmen.
